Follow-up study on serum cholesterol profiles and potential sequelae in recovered COVID-19 patients

Abstract: Background COVID-19 patients develop hypolipidemia. However, it is unknown whether lipid levels have improved and there are potential sequlae in recovered patients. Objective In this follow-up study, we evaluated serum lipidemia and various physiopathological laboratory values in recovered patients.
